Abstract:
The textbook covers theoretical and applied issues of teaching children to read literature based on the material of works of Russian and foreign literature, including folklore. The content of the book introduces the reader to the world of children's literature, introduces the genre features of the works of the circle of children's readers and the most famous authors. The publication is a workshop on expressive reading, which is one of the components of students' speech training. The book recreates the world of writers primarily through the word and a kind of artistic thinking. Numerous quotations from works of fiction fulfill this task. The textbook describes the stages of development of genres of oral folk art: fairy tales, songs, jokes. Examples with distinctive features of "Christian fantasy" and "occult fantasy" are given. The works of Russian poets are briefly described: K.I. Chukovsky, V.A. Zhukovsky, A.S. Pushkin and other authors. Abstract:
An eye-opening look at the latest research findings about the success of free voluntary reading in developing high levels of literacy. Free voluntary reading looks better and more powerful than ever. Stephen D. Krashen, PhD, is an advocate for free voluntary reading in schools and has published many journal articles on the subject. Free Voluntary Reading: Power 2010 collects the last ten years of his extensive work and reconsiders all aspects of this important debate in light of the latest findings. The book provides an accessible examination of topics, such as free voluntary reading's value in language and literary acquisition domestically and worldwide, recent developments in support of free voluntary reading, whether rewards-based programs benefit the development of lifelong reading, the value of phonics in reading instruction, and trends in literacy in the United States.

Abstract:
More than a simple guide through a complicated text, this book serves both as an introduction and as a distillation of more than thirty years of reading and reflection on Max Weber's scholarship. It is a solid and comprehensive study of Weber and his main concepts. It also provides commentary in a manner informed both historically and sociologically. Drawing on recent research in the history of law, the book also presents and critiques the process by which the law was rationalized and which Weber divided into four ideal-typical stages of development. It contextualizes Weber's work in the light of current research, setting out to amend misinterpretations and misunderstandings that have prevailed from Weber's original texts.
